Pump Yer Maw: To have sexual intercourse with another person's … WebThe word ken, meaning understanding or perception, is now rarely used outside Scotland. The first references to 'beyond our ken' aren't from the UK though but from America. The earliest I can find is in the Gettysburg newspaper The Republican Banner, in November 1834: "But you in a strange mood to-day, and since the balloon is beyond our ken ...
